Output 58481d41ab0ed372e803288a4a1543e45f6285845917a299e70d811e653e3f95:129

value
3093381
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db7fd1be7e04f9b39a006115ca1e6110cd43fa798129f381e0562b48539b24de
address
bc1pmdlar0n7qnum8xsqvy2u58npzrx587nesy5l8q0q2c45s5umyn0q9njhhy
transaction
58481d41ab0ed372e803288a4a1543e45f6285845917a299e70d811e653e3f95
spent
true